Web behavior analysis has become a key component of defending online properties like banks, benefits, e-commerce, and research sites from attacks. A 2010 study by Pew Internet showed that 82% of internet users access government via the internet. Since the government sector has many components that are analogous to private organizations, web behavior analytics is equally applicable to these government entities.
